An Instantaneous Rigid Force Model For 3-Axis Ball-End Milling Of Sculptured Surfaces
An instantaneous rigid force model for prediction of cutting forces in ball-end milling of sculptured surfaces is presented in this paper. A commercially available geometric engine is used to represent the cutting edge, cutter and updated part geometries. The cutter used in this work is an insert type ball-end mill. متن کاملCreating a longitudinal integrated clerkship with mutual benefits for an academic medical center and a community health system.
The longitudinal integrated clerkship is a model of clinical education driven by tenets of social cognitive theory, situated learning, and workplace learning theories, and built on a foundation of continuity between students, patients, clinicians, and a system of care.
